Despite the recent acquisition of Anthony Gordon, England international Marcus Rashford remains firmly committed to his future at Barcelona. The arrival of a new offensive player has sparked discussions about the attacking lineup for the upcoming season, but Rashford views this development not as a sign of his departure, but as a challenge to reaffirm his position within the squad.
Rashford is patiently awaiting a clear directive from the club before making any definitive decisions about his career path. He has found the atmosphere within the Barcelona dressing room to be exceptionally positive, fostering strong connections with coach Hansi Flick and his staff. This supportive environment, coupled with the style of play under Flick's guidance, has only deepened his desire to continue his journey with the team, despite external interest from other clubs.
A critical factor influencing Rashford's potential long-term stay is Barcelona's financial situation. The club must carefully manage its spending, especially with a reported €30 million purchase option for Rashford and the prospect of a three-year contract. Nevertheless, Rashford's resolve to remain at Barcelona is unwavering, fueled by his positive experiences and the encouragement from his coach.
